Plan Commission Minutes of December 27, 2007 Print E-mail

The Plan Commission met at City Hall in the City of Black River Falls on December 27, 2007 at 6:30 P.M. Commissioners Johnson, Boisen, Bjerke and Tamminen were present. Commissioners Evenson and Moe were absent. Mayor Joseph Hunter presided.

 

1.Mayor Hunter opened the public hearing for the Evangelical Lutheran Church request for a conditional use permit for a parking lot for property they are purchasing directly east of their current parking lot as published. Joe Gaier represented the church to explain their request.

 

2.Gary Onstad, the adjoining property owner to the east, requested a 10’ setback from the west edge of his property line to the paved parking area. He also requested trees or shrubs be planted there to act as a windbreak.

 

3.Mayor Hunter advised the Commission that the property was valued at $92,800.00 with taxes of $1942.00 of which the City would receive about one-third. The property would be tax exempt to the church. The Mayor did not express opposition to the request.

 

4.It was moved by Commissioner Bjerke, seconded by Commissioner Boisen to grant the Evangelical Lutheran Church a conditional use permit to establish a parking lot on the premises as published. The permit is conditioned on a 10’ setback from the east edge of the property to the pavement and some type of planting in the 10’ setback area that is acceptable to the property owner to the east. Motion carried.

 

5. Mayor Hunter opened the public hearing for the Jeff Hagenbrock/Chad Mickelson request for a conditional use permit to construct self-service rental storage units west of Alder Street and north of Black River Auto Sales as published.

 

6.The plan for construction of four separate storage buildings was presented. The owner will start with two buildings in the spring. The stormwater drainage will either be directed to Alder Street or taken care of with a detention pond on the property.

 

7. It was moved by Commissioner Tamminen, seconded by Commissioner Johnson to grant the conditional use permit as above with the condition of the stormwater drainage to Alder Street or on-site detention. Motion carried.

 

8. It was moved by Commissioner Boisen, seconded by Mayor Hunter to adjourn.  Motion carried.

 

 William Arndt

 City Clerk
